Louise Oppenheimer
Louise believes that hand weaving both stimulates and calms the mind in equal measure. With wool in hand the head is free to roam while the heart beats in time to the slow process of pulling warp through weft.
Ideas in pen drawings grow into tactile, colourful images on the loom which aim to convey Louise’s deep satisfaction to live in this beautiful place.
Visitors are very welcome to view sketchbooks, touch tapestries and try a little weaving on small frames.
